"almesse" meaning in Middle English

See almesse in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: /ˈalmɛs(ə)/, /ˈalməs(ə)/, /ˈɛlmɛs(ə)/, /ˈɛlməs(ə)/ (note: especially East Anglia, Kent, or West Midland), /ˈalmus/ [Northern, especially]
Etymology: From Old English ælmesse, from Proto-West Germanic *alemōsinā, a borrowing from Vulgar Latin *alemosyna. Forms with /u/ are probably borrowed from Old Norse ǫlmusa or influenced by it.
